#Cynthia Zhu
#Professor Krzyzanowski
#Computer Security (01:198:419:02)
#February 20, 2022
#Project 1
import pickle
from sys import argv
from collections import defaultdict
user_password = defaultdict(str)
domain_users = defaultdict(list)
type_objects = defaultdict(list)
operation_domain_type = defaultdict(list)
def print_success():
print("Success")
def print_missing_command():
print("Error: Missing command")
def print_invalid(x):
print("Error: Invalid " + x)
def print_too_few_arguments():
print("Error: Too few arguments")
def print_too_many_arguments():
print("Error: Too many arguments")
def print_user_exists():
print("Error: User already exists")
def print_not_found(x):
print("Error: " + x + " not found")
def print_incorrect_password():
print("Error: Incorrect password")
def print_access_denied():
print("Error: Access denied")
#auth.py AddUser user password
def add_user():
global user_password
if len(argv) < 4:
print_too_few_arguments()
return
if len(argv) > 4:
print_too_many_arguments()
return
user = argv[2]
if user == "":
print_invalid("username")
return
password = argv[3]
if user in user_password:
print_user_exists()
return
user_password[user] = password
print_success()
#auth.py Authenticate user password
def authenticate():
global user_password
if len(argv) < 4:
print_too_few_arguments()
return
if len(argv) > 4:
print_too_many_arguments()
return
user = argv[2]
if user == "":
print_invalid("username")
return
password = argv[3]
if user not in user_password:
print_not_found("User")
return
if user_password[user] == password:
print_success()
else:
print_incorrect_password()
#auth.py SetDomain user domain
def set_domain():
global user_password
global domain_users
if len(argv) < 4:
print_too_few_arguments()
return
if len(argv) > 4:
print_too_many_arguments()
return
user = argv[2]
if user == "":
print_invalid("username")
return
domain = argv[3]
if domain == "":
print_invalid("domain")
return
if user not in user_password:
print_not_found("User")
return
if user not in domain_users[domain]:
domain_users[domain].append(user)
print_success()
#auth.py DomainInfo domain
def domain_info():
global domain_users
if len(argv) < 3:
print_too_few_arguments()
return
if len(argv) > 3:
print_too_many_arguments()
return
domain = argv[2]
if domain == "":
print_invalid("domain")
return
if domain in domain_users and len(domain_users[domain]) > 0:
for user in domain_users[domain]:
print(user)
#auth.py SetType object type
def set_type():
global type_objects
if len(argv) < 4:
print_too_few_arguments()
return
if len(argv) > 4:
print_too_many_arguments()
return
object = argv[2]
if object == "":
print_invalid("object")
return
type = argv[3]
if type == "":
print_invalid("type")
return
if object not in type_objects[type]:
type_objects[type].append(object)
print_success()
#auth.py TypeInfo type
def type_info():
global type_objects
if len(argv) < 3:
print_too_few_arguments()
return
if len(argv) > 3:
print_too_many_arguments()
return
type = argv[2]
if type == "":
print_invalid("type")
return
if type in type_objects and len(type_objects[type]) > 0:
for object in type_objects[type]:
print(object)
#auth.py AddAccess operation domain type
def add_access():
global domain_users
global type_objects
global operation_domain_type
if len(argv) < 5:
print_too_few_arguments()
return
if len(argv) > 5:
print_too_many_arguments()
return
operation = argv[2]
if operation == "":
print_invalid("operation")
return
domain = argv[3]
if domain == "":
print_invalid("domain")
return
type = argv[4]
if type == "":
print_invalid("type")
return
if domain not in domain_users:
domain_users[domain]
if type not in type_objects:
type_objects[type]
if (domain, type) not in operation_domain_type[operation]:
operation_domain_type[operation].append((domain, type))
print_success()
#auth.py CanAccess operation user object
def can_access():
global user_password
global domain_users
global type_objects
global operation_domain_type
if len(argv) < 5:
print_too_few_arguments()
return
if len(argv) > 5:
print_too_many_arguments()
return
operation = argv[2]
if operation == "":
print_invalid("operation")
return
user = argv[3]
if user == "":
print_invalid("username")
return
object = argv[4]
if object == "":
print_invalid("object")
return
if operation not in operation_domain_type:
print_not_found("Operation")
return
if user not in user_password:
print_not_found("User")
return
if object not in set().union(*type_objects.values()):
print_not_found("Object")
return
domains = []
for d in domain_users:
if user in domain_users[d]:
domains.append(d)
types = []
for t in type_objects:
if object in type_objects[t]:
types.append(t)
for d in domains:
for t in types:
if (d, t) in operation_domain_type[operation]:
print_success()
return
print_access_denied()
def read_command():
if len(argv) == 1:
print_missing_command()
return
command = argv[1]
if command == "AddUser":
add_user()
elif command == "Authenticate":
authenticate()
elif command == "SetDomain":
set_domain()
elif command == "DomainInfo":
domain_info()
elif command == "SetType":
set_type()
elif command == "TypeInfo":
type_info()
elif command == "AddAccess":
add_access()
elif command == "CanAccess":
can_access()
else:
print_invalid("command")
return
def import_data():
global user_password
global domain_users
global type_objects
global operation_domain_type
try:
with open("user_password.pickle", "rb") as user_password_input_file:
user_password = pickle.load(user_password_input_file)
except FileNotFoundError:
pass
try:
with open("domain_users.pickle", "rb") as domain_users_input_file:
domain_users = pickle.load(domain_users_input_file)
except FileNotFoundError:
pass
try:
with open("type_objects.pickle", "rb") as type_objects_input_file:
type_objects = pickle.load(type_objects_input_file)
except FileNotFoundError:
pass
try:
with open("operation_domain_type.pickle", "rb") as operation_domain_type_input_file:
operation_domain_type = pickle.load(operation_domain_type_input_file)
except FileNotFoundError:
pass
return
def export_data():
global user_password
global domain_users
global type_objects
global operation_domain_type
with open("user_password.pickle", "wb") as user_password_output_file:
pickle.dump(user_password, user_password_output_file, pickle.HIGHEST_PROTOCOL)
with open("domain_users.pickle", "wb") as domain_users_output_file:
pickle.dump(domain_users, domain_users_output_file, pickle.HIGHEST_PROTOCOL)
with open("type_objects.pickle", "wb") as type_objects_output_file:
pickle.dump(type_objects, type_objects_output_file, pickle.HIGHEST_PROTOCOL)
with open("operation_domain_type.pickle", "wb") as operation_domain_type_output_file:
pickle.dump(operation_domain_type, operation_domain_type_output_file, pickle.HIGHEST_PROTOCOL)
return
def main():
import_data()
read_command()
export_data()
if __name__ == "__main__":
main()
